#8dbef5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8dbef5 is composed of 55.3% red, 74.5%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.4% cyan, 22.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 211.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 75.7%. #8dbef5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1b7deb.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

Shades and Tints of #8dbef5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060c is the darkest color, while #f9f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8dbef5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dc1c5 is the less saturated color, while #83bdff is the most saturated one.
